■Illuminated entry system
Vehicles without a smart key system
When  the  interior lights  switch is  in the door position, the interior lights auto-
matically  turn  on/off  according  to  the  power  switch  position,  whether  the
doors are locked/unlocked, and whether the doors are open/close d.
Vehicles with a smart key system
When  the  interior lights  switch is  in the door position, the interior lights auto-
matically  turn  on/off  according  to  power  switch  mode,  the  presence  of  the
electronic key, whether the doors are locked/unlocked, and whet her the doors
are open/closed.
■ To prevent 12-volt battery discharge
Vehicles without a smart key system
If  the  interior  lights,  personal  lights  or  luggage  compartment  light  remain  on
when the power switch is “LOCK” position, the lights will go of f automatically
after 20 minutes.
Vehicles with a smart key system
If  the  interior  lights,  personal  lights  or  luggage  compartment  light  remain  on
when the power switch is off, the lights will go off automatica lly after 20 min-
utes.
■ Customization that can be configured at Toyota dealer
Settings (e.g. the time elapsed before lights turn off) can be changed. 
(Customizable features:  P. 560)

■ Stopping the hybrid system
Shift the shift lever to P and press the power switch as you normally do when
stopping the hybrid system.
■ Replacing the key battery
As the above procedure is a temporary measure, it is recommende d that the
electronic key battery be replaced immediately when the battery is depleted.
( P. 451)
■ Changing power switch modes
Release the brake pedal and press the power switch in   above.
The  hybrid  system  does  not  start  and  modes  will  be  changed  each  time the
switch is pressed. ( P. 193)
■ If the doors cannot be locked o r unlocked by the smart key syst em
Lock and unlock the doors by the mechanical key or wireless rem ote control.
■ When the electronic key does not work properly
●Make  sure  that  the  smart  key  system  has  not  been  deactivated  in   the  cus-
tomization setting. If it is off, turn the function on. 
(Customizable features:  P. 560)
● Check if battery-saving mode is set. If it is set, cancel the f unction. 
( P. 142)
